Women Who Give

Women Who Give (1924)

Directed by Reginald Barker

Plot

Jonathan Swift, stern Cape Cod businessman, has ambitions for his children, Emily and Noah, which are thwarted when they take romantic interests in Capt. Joe Cradlebow and Becky Keeler, respectively. Not realizing that Becky expects a child and has been promised marriage, Swift has Noah shanghaied, while Becky stows away on Cradlebow's vessel. There is a terrific storm; but Cradlebow rescues Noah, and the fleet returns safely to shore--thanks to lighthouse keeper Bijonah Keeler, Becky's father, who sets his house afire to give the sailors light. Realizing his foolishness Swift relents allowing his children marry whom they please.
